Mountains, lakes, hills and plains. In a varied and fascinating landscape, Piedmont gathers cities known for their architectural and historical beauties (such as Turin) and others that preserve, without clamor, world-wide peculiarities.
It happens, for example, in Vercelli, where the oldest known English manuscript is found and consulted by scholars from all over the world. This is the Codex Vercellensis Evangeliorum, the so-called Evangeliary of St. Eusebius, and is a fourth-century manuscript.
But Piedmont, with its thousands of landscaps, is also the region where entrepreneurship has become a school, gaining international fame: from Ferrero to Lavazza, from Fiat to Olivetti, and if you are looking for a tasting holiday, Piedmont is the land of truffles (the subject of a prestigious international auction), wines (first of all Barolo) and the Piedmontese beef, the undisputed specialty of the Alta Langa.
